Before becoming the \u201cBuddhist brain guy\u201d Dr. Rick spent over 30 years working in private practice as a couples counselor and family therapist. Today we\u2019re leaning on that experience, and learning what we can do to build healthier, happier, and more fulfilling relationships.\nWatch the Episode: Prefer watching video?
